Output 3c8e2c6e40744727583968e990a46fa3dcbbab3722b366128ad1ce5efec975b6:5

value
25176497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45150128a5b157ed4f8c2a3bee91c4aeaddf4487 OP_EQUAL
address
MECS25yUtd2U2PtDTMoDarHri3VHViCwRk
transaction
3c8e2c6e40744727583968e990a46fa3dcbbab3722b366128ad1ce5efec975b6
spent
true